I am not sure if our orders were special in some way, but if our exact configuration can help other get their Broncos sooner I hope this helps.
My twin @Zombie Salamander and I first ordered back on 10/15/21, both for Badlands 2 door high package with the roof rack, towing, and SAS. More or less a year went by with no change, and on 10/11/22 we re-upped for the 23 model year. When we re-upped we both ordered Badlands 2 door manuals, high package, towing package, with the optional wheels (configured with BFG tires instead of the Goodyears) and with the base headlights (asked the dealer to spec the base lights as we liked the style of those more). We decided not to go for the SAS package as we found out it didn't add much for us Badlands manual folks. In late November I got the confirmation that my order was in production (blend of 11/22/22), with my brother's order being produced on 12/12/22. A convoy shipped from the factory right after each truck was produced and they were at the dealer a day later (perks of living in Michigan). We picked them both up on 12/26/2022. EDIT: I almost forgot, we ordered from a small dealership in northern Michigan.
